The scandal highlighted the terrifying reality of digital voyeurism. Long before terms like "deepfakes" or widespread "revenge porn" dominated global headlines, the Lee case exposed how easily digital technology could be weaponized to destroy lives. The leak of portions of Lee's video archive onto peer-to-peer file-sharing networks during the trial caused secondary trauma to the victims, prompting stricter laws against the dissemination of non-consensual explicit imagery.
